I guess DVdactive has the list of extras up now.
"Sony Pictures Home Entertainment has announced a 15th Anniversary Edition of Groundhog Day which stars Bill Murray, Andie MacDowell, and Chris Elliott. This Harold Ramis directed film will be available to own from the 29th January. The film itself will be presented in 1.85:1 anamorphic widescreen, along with an English Dolby Digital 5.1 Surround track. Extras will include an audio commentary with Director Harold Ramis, a Weight of Time Documentary, The Study of Groundhogs: A Real Life Look at Marmots featurette, A Different Day: An Interview with Harold Ramis, and deleted scenes.
